// Description : BinkleyTerm Phone list Search Module

/* Include this file before any other includes or defines! */

#include "includes.h"

static int LOCALFUNC SaveScanList (int);
static void LOCALFUNC wait_for_keypress (void);

int
list_search ()
{
    int saved_baud;
    long t1;
    int i, k, l;
    int dirty;
    ADDR addr;
    ADDR* addrp;
    unsigned int kbd_input;
    char junk[256];

    static unsigned int save_chars[] =
        {
            SHF1, SHF2, SHF3, SHF4, SHF5,
            SHF6, SHF7, SHF8, SHF9, SHF10
        };

    static unsigned int load_chars[] =
        {
            ALTF1, ALTF2, ALTF3, ALTF4, ALTF5,
            ALTF6, ALTF7, ALTF8, ALTF9, ALTF10
        };

    static unsigned int command_chars[] =
        {
            PF1, PF2, PF3, PF4, PF5,
            PF6, PF7, PF8, PF9, PF10
        };

    /* Input the phone numbers we want to scan */

    dirty = 1;

    /* Print out a null string in a nice way for unforgiving OS. */

#define NICE_TEXT(n) (((n) == NULL) ? "(none)" : n)

    for (;;)
    {
        if (dirty)
        {
            screen_clear ();
            printf (MSG_TXT (M_PHONE_HELP));
            printf (MSG_TXT (M_PHONE_HELP2));
            if (set_loaded)
                printf (MSG_TXT (M_LAST_SET), set_loaded);
            printf (MSG_TXT (M_CURRENT_PHONES));
            for (k = 0; k < 10; k += 2)
            {
                printf ("%2d: %35s %2d: %35s\n", k + 1,
                        NICE_TEXT (scan_list[k]), k + 2,
                        NICE_TEXT (scan_list[k + 1]));
            }
            printf (MSG_TXT (M_INPUT_COMMAND));
            dirty = 0;
        }

        while (!KEYPRESS ())
            time_release ();
        kbd_input = FOSSIL_CHAR ();

        if (((kbd_input & 0xff) == '\n') || ((kbd_input & 0xff) == '\r'))
            break;

        if ((kbd_input & 0xff) == ESC)
            return (0);

        for (k = 0; k < 10; k++)
        {
            if (kbd_input == save_chars[k])  /* Save into a set?     */
            {
                SaveScanList (k);       /* Yes, do it           */
                dirty = 1;              /* Force redisplay      */
                k = 10;                 /* Then fool the logic  */
                break;
            }

            if (kbd_input == load_chars[k])  /* Load from a set?     */
            {
                LoadScanList (k, 1);    /* Yes, do it           */
                dirty = 1;              /* Force redisplay      */
                k = 10;                 /* Then fool the logic  */
                break;
            }

            if (kbd_input == command_chars[k])  /* Plain old Fkey?      */
                break;                  /* Yup, get out now     */
        }

        if (k == 10)                /* Not a function key   */
        {
            k = (kbd_input & 0xff) - '0';  /* Convert from digit   */
            if ((k < 0) || (k > 9))   /* Was it a digit?      */
                continue;               /* No, throw char out   */
            if (!k)                   /* Is it a zero?        */
                k = 9;                  /* That's 9 to us       */
            else
                --k;                    /* Else make zero-rel   */
        }

        printf (MSG_TXT (M_ELEMENT_CHOSEN), k + 1);
        if (scan_list[k] != NULL)
        {
            printf (MSG_TXT (M_CURRENTLY_CONTAINS), scan_list[k]);
            printf (MSG_TXT (M_PHONE_HELP3));
        }
        else
        {
            printf (MSG_TXT (M_PHONE_HELP4));
        }
        // gets (junk);                         /* Get user's input     */
        // CEH 990104: this was not safe
        fgets (junk, sizeof (junk), stdin);
        ++dirty;                    /* Always redisplay     */
        if ((l = (int) strlen (junk)) == 0)  /* If nothing there,    */
            continue;                 /* move along           */

        if (l == 1 && *junk == ' ') /* If just a space...   */
        {
            if (scan_list[k] != NULL) /* Delete old number    */
                free (scan_list[k]);
            scan_list[k] = NULL;      /* Clean up the ref     */
            continue;                 /* End this iteration   */
        }

        /* Get rid of old num if any */

        if (scan_list[k] != NULL)
        {
            free (scan_list[k]);
        }

        /* Allocate space for new num */

        if ((scan_list[k] = (char*)calloc (1, (unsigned int) (++l))) == NULL)
        {
            printf (MSG_TXT (M_MEM_ERROR));
            return (0);               /* Get out for error    */
        }
        strcpy (scan_list[k], junk);  /* Save new number      */
    }

    /* Actual Search logic */

    status_line (MSG_TXT (M_STARTING_SCAN));
    for (;;)
    {
        l = 0;
        for (k = 0; k < 10; k++)
        {
            if (scan_list[k] == NULL)
                continue;
            addrp = NULL;
            strcpy (junk, scan_list[k]);
            if (!isdigit (junk[0]) && junk[0] != '\"')
            {
// TODO                (*userfunc) (junk, &addr);
                if ((addr.Net != 0xffff)
                        && (addr.Node != 0xffff)
                        && (addr.Zone != 0xffff))
                {
                    sprintf (junk, "%s", Full_Addr_Str (&addr));
                    addrp = &addr;
                }
                else
                    continue;
            }
            if (strchr (junk, '/') != NULL)
            {
                char *c;

                c = skip_blanks (junk);
                if (find_address (c, &addr))
                    addrp = &addr;

                if (!nodeproc (junk))
                    break;

                status_line (MSG_TXT (M_PROCESSING_NODE),
                             Full_Addr_Str (&addr),
                             newnodedes.SystemName);

                strcpy (junk, (char *) (newnodedes.PhoneNumber));
            }
            saved_baud = baud;

            if (try_1_connect (junk, addrp))  /* Attempt to connect */
            {
                status_line (MSG_TXT (M_CONNECTED_TO_ITEM), k + 1);
                free (scan_list[k]);
                scan_list[k] = NULL;
                gong ();
                return (1);
            }

            ++l;
            baud = saved_baud;
            program_baud ();
            cur_baud = pbtypes[baud];
            t1 = timerset (2 * PER_SECOND);

            while (!timeup (t1))      /* pause for 2 seconds  */
            {
                if (KEYPRESS ())
                {
                    i = FOSSIL_CHAR () & 0xff;
                    if (i == ESC)         /* Abort for ESCape     */
                    {
                        status_line (MSG_TXT (M_CONNECT_ABORTED));
                        return (0);
                    }
                }
                time_release ();
            }
        }

        if (!l)
            break;
    }

    return (0);
}

int
LoadScanList (int number, int report_errors)
{
    int k, l;
    FILE *ScanFile;
    char junk[256];

    sprintf (junk, "%sBinkScan.LS%c", BINKpath, number + '0');
    if ((ScanFile = fopen (junk, read_binary)) == NULL)
    {
        if (report_errors)
        {
            printf (MSG_TXT (M_UNABLE_TO_OPEN), junk);
            printf ("\n");
            wait_for_keypress ();
        }
        return (0);
    }

    for (k = 0; k < 10; k++)
    {
        if (fread (junk, 36, 1, ScanFile) != 1)
        {
            if (report_errors)
            {
                printf (MSG_TXT (M_SET_READ_ERROR), number + 1);
                wait_for_keypress ();
            }
            fclose (ScanFile);
            return (0);
        }

        if (scan_list[k] != NULL)
        {
            free (scan_list[k]);
            scan_list[k] = NULL;
        }

        l = (int) strlen (junk);
        if (l)
        {
            if ((scan_list[k] = (char*)calloc (1, (unsigned int) (++l))) == NULL)  /* Allocate space    */
            {
                if (report_errors)
                {
                    printf (MSG_TXT (M_MEM_ERROR));
                    wait_for_keypress ();
                }
                fclose (ScanFile);
                return (0);
            }

            strcpy (scan_list[k], junk);  /* Save new number   */
        }
    }

    l = fclose (ScanFile);
    if (report_errors)
    {
        if (l)
            printf (MSG_TXT (M_SET_CLOSE_ERR), number + 1);
        else
        {
            printf (MSG_TXT (M_SET_LOADED), number + 1);
            set_loaded = number + 1;
        }
        wait_for_keypress ();
    }

    return (l);
}

static int LOCALFUNC
SaveScanList (int number)
{
    int k, l;
    FILE *ScanFile;
    char junk[256];

    sprintf (junk, "%sBinkScan.LS%c", BINKpath, number + '0');
    if ((ScanFile = fopen (junk, write_binary)) == NULL)
    {
        printf (MSG_TXT (M_UNABLE_TO_OPEN), junk);
        printf ("\n");
        wait_for_keypress ();
        return (0);
    }

    for (k = 0; k < 10; k++)
    {
        for (l = 0; l < 36; l++)
            junk[l] = '\0';

        if (scan_list[k] != NULL)
            strcpy (junk, scan_list[k]);

        if (fwrite (junk, 36, 1, ScanFile) != 1)
        {
            printf (MSG_TXT (M_SET_WRITE_ERROR), number + 1);
            wait_for_keypress ();
            fclose (ScanFile);
            return (0);
        }
    }

    l = fclose (ScanFile);
    if (l)
        printf (MSG_TXT (M_SET_CLOSE_ERR), number + 1);
    else
    {
        printf (MSG_TXT (M_SET_SAVED), number + 1);
        set_loaded = number + 1;
    }

    wait_for_keypress ();
    return (l);
}

static void LOCALFUNC
wait_for_keypress (void)
{
    printf ("%s\n", MSG_TXT (M_PRESS_ENTER));
    while (!KEYPRESS ())
        time_release ();
    FOSSIL_CHAR ();
}

/* $Id: b_search.cpp,v 1.1 2005/01/01 15:18:11 vildanov Exp $ */
